Transaction 57489a464fd5569136e88a82498833df0bbf9bb320f3952928f2cd1530f956ac
1 Input
1 Output
-
57489a464fd5569136e88a82498833df0bbf9bb320f3952928f2cd1530f956ac:0
- value
- 2138646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 769b8a4f6c30f3e43a28f24e1f4be27782045da1 OP_EQUAL
- address
- 3CW9zJnaiCYX2viiRktwoaG5QywBozzQHF